.idl .menu ul {
  margin: 0px;
}

.idl .mlddm{
   text-transform:uppercase;	
   visibility: hidden;
   margin: 0;
   padding: 0;
   white-space: nowrap;
   overflow: hidden;
   width: 100%;
}

.idl .mlddm li {
   display: inline;
   list-style: none;
   float: left;
   margin: 0;
   padding: 0
}

.idl .mlddm li a,
.idl .mlddm li a#buttonnohover{
   display: block;
   margin: 0 5px 0 0;
   padding: 4px;
   padding-right: 10px;
   font-weight:bold;
   font-size:17px;
   text-align: center;
   text-decoration: none;
   white-space: nowrap;
   color: #7CA618;
}


.idl .mlddm ul{
   z-index: 100;
   position: absolute;
   visibility: hidden;
   margin: 2px 0 0 0;
   padding: 0;
   border-color: #827A67;
   border-width: 0px 1px 1px 1px;
   border-style: solid;
}

.idl .mlddm ul li{
   float: none
}

.idl .mlddm ul li a{
   display: block;
   width: auto;
   margin: 0;
   padding: 5px 17px 5px 13px;
   text-align: left;
   text-transform: none;
   white-space: pre;
   color: #000;
   background: #ffe;
}


.idl .mlddm li.selected a,
.idl .mlddm li a:hover {
  color: #F02A7B;
}

